
Giovanni Ricotta developed core gameplay systems and infrastructure for the CreateNuclearFabric repository, focusing on modular world generation, reactor mechanics, and data-driven configuration. He engineered features such as a fluid interaction system, radiation HUD overlays, and advancement progression, leveraging Java and the Fabric API to ensure extensibility and maintainability. His work included refactoring tag systems for unified input validation, implementing asset pipelines, and enhancing build automation with Gradle and CI/CD workflows. By addressing both backend logic and client-side rendering, Giovanni delivered reliable, configurable mod features that improved gameplay balance, developer efficiency, and future extensibility, demonstrating depth in both design and implementation.

August 2025 was focused on delivering core features for the CreateNuclearFabric project while improving code quality and maintainability. Key outcomes include a configuration-driven world generation system for the CreateNuclear mod, enabling tunable explosions, world generation, and rod properties; and a refactor of the tag system to CNTag/CNTags with unified tag-based input validation, improving accuracy and extensibility across items, blocks, fluids, and entities. The work also eliminated unused code and updated integration points to support future mod interoperability.
August 2025 was focused on delivering core features for the CreateNuclearFabric project while improving code quality and maintainability. Key outcomes include a configuration-driven world generation system for the CreateNuclear mod, enabling tunable explosions, world generation, and rod properties; and a refactor of the tag system to CNTag/CNTags with unified tag-based input validation, improving accuracy and extensibility across items, blocks, fluids, and entities. The work also eliminated unused code and updated integration points to support future mod interoperability.
June 2025: Delivered targeted stability improvements and a refactor in the CreateNuclearFabric project. Key fixes ensured accurate heat calculations and reactor state handling, while an internal refactor improved initialization flow and code maintainability. These changes enhance simulation reliability, reduce operational risk, and prepare the codebase for upcoming heat-management enhancements.
June 2025: Delivered targeted stability improvements and a refactor in the CreateNuclearFabric project. Key fixes ensured accurate heat calculations and reactor state handling, while an internal refactor improved initialization flow and code maintainability. These changes enhance simulation reliability, reduce operational risk, and prepare the codebase for upcoming heat-management enhancements.
May 2025 performance summary for valentinlamine/CreateNuclearFabric: Delivered key gameplay features, reliability fixes, and performance improvements across core CN mod and related systems. Notable work includes Fluid Interaction System, Radiation HUD and damage mechanics, CN mod core overhaul with updated recipes and world integration, Advancement system enhancements, and comprehensive data generation/resource cache maintenance. The work improved player-facing gameplay, balance, and developer efficiency.
May 2025 performance summary for valentinlamine/CreateNuclearFabric: Delivered key gameplay features, reliability fixes, and performance improvements across core CN mod and related systems. Notable work includes Fluid Interaction System, Radiation HUD and damage mechanics, CN mod core overhaul with updated recipes and world integration, Advancement system enhancements, and comprehensive data generation/resource cache maintenance. The work improved player-facing gameplay, balance, and developer efficiency.
April 2025 monthly summary for valentinlamine/CreateNuclearFabric: Delivered major visual fidelity, world-gen realism, and UX improvements across core features. Implemented Autunite connected textures and block-pattern integration for consistent visuals across variants; introduced biome-aware ore distribution with striated overworld ores and adjusted height ranges for uranium/lead to improve realism and balance; refined irradiated vision HUD and helmet overlay including alpha handling and status feedback; tuned reactor core configuration and heat management for better safety margins and gameplay balance; added raw ore processing recipe generation using a new rawOre helper to standardize crushing outputs. These changes enhance player immersion, support balanced exploration and progression, and improve maintainability through refactoring and improved data generation.
April 2025 monthly summary for valentinlamine/CreateNuclearFabric: Delivered major visual fidelity, world-gen realism, and UX improvements across core features. Implemented Autunite connected textures and block-pattern integration for consistent visuals across variants; introduced biome-aware ore distribution with striated overworld ores and adjusted height ranges for uranium/lead to improve realism and balance; refined irradiated vision HUD and helmet overlay including alpha handling and status feedback; tuned reactor core configuration and heat management for better safety margins and gameplay balance; added raw ore processing recipe generation using a new rawOre helper to standardize crushing outputs. These changes enhance player immersion, support balanced exploration and progression, and improve maintainability through refactoring and improved data generation.
March 2025: Monthly summary for the CreateNuclearFabric repo focusing on delivering UI/UX improvements, data and asset alignment for edible yellowcake module, and modular reactor balance changes. Key outcomes include updated HUD rendering with new textures and conditional hotbar rendering; improved radiation effect behavior tied to armor state with robust removal logic for immune entities; refreshed data generation resources and asset caches to align recipes, assets, and advancements with the latest configurations; and a comprehensive reactor configuration overhaul introducing modular explosion and rod configurations, refined explosion duration, rod lifespans, heat capacity, and proximity effects. These changes enhance gameplay fidelity, balance, and maintainability, while improving development workflows through clearer commit traceability and configuration-driven design.
March 2025: Monthly summary for the CreateNuclearFabric repo focusing on delivering UI/UX improvements, data and asset alignment for edible yellowcake module, and modular reactor balance changes. Key outcomes include updated HUD rendering with new textures and conditional hotbar rendering; improved radiation effect behavior tied to armor state with robust removal logic for immune entities; refreshed data generation resources and asset caches to align recipes, assets, and advancements with the latest configurations; and a comprehensive reactor configuration overhaul introducing modular explosion and rod configurations, refined explosion duration, rod lifespans, heat capacity, and proximity effects. These changes enhance gameplay fidelity, balance, and maintainability, while improving development workflows through clearer commit traceability and configuration-driven design.
February 2025: Delivered UX, configurability, and stability improvements to valentinlamine/CreateNuclearFabric, focusing on in-game feedback, reactor behavior tuning, and a modular architecture to support future features. These changes deliver clear business value by enhancing player clarity, tunability, and reliability across core gameplay and mod infrastructure.
February 2025: Delivered UX, configurability, and stability improvements to valentinlamine/CreateNuclearFabric, focusing on in-game feedback, reactor behavior tuning, and a modular architecture to support future features. These changes deliver clear business value by enhancing player clarity, tunability, and reliability across core gameplay and mod infrastructure.
January 2025 highlights for valentinlamine/CreateNuclearFabric: Delivered core feature updates, stability fixes, and maintainability improvements with clear business value. Focused on improving UX with text handling and tooltips, enhancing progression via armor progression in the Advancement system, and strengthening localization readiness and code readability. Implemented a robust set of bug fixes that reduce user friction and improve world consistency, while simplifying future development through refactors and asset/text management.
January 2025 highlights for valentinlamine/CreateNuclearFabric: Delivered core feature updates, stability fixes, and maintainability improvements with clear business value. Focused on improving UX with text handling and tooltips, enhancing progression via armor progression in the Advancement system, and strengthening localization readiness and code readability. Implemented a robust set of bug fixes that reduce user friction and improve world consistency, while simplifying future development through refactors and asset/text management.
December 2024 (Month: 2024-12) monthly summary for valentinlamine/CreateNuclearFabric. Focus on business value and technical achievements across nine changes: build reliability, energy output accuracy, ponder configuration, armor texture integrity, forging tag improvements, edible property removal, reactor crafting recipe, lead/steel shapeless recipes, and data generation/localization updates. These efforts delivered stable builds, improved balance, richer gameplay interactions, and more robust data pipelines, enabling faster iteration and more reliable community deployments.
December 2024 (Month: 2024-12) monthly summary for valentinlamine/CreateNuclearFabric. Focus on business value and technical achievements across nine changes: build reliability, energy output accuracy, ponder configuration, armor texture integrity, forging tag improvements, edible property removal, reactor crafting recipe, lead/steel shapeless recipes, and data generation/localization updates. These efforts delivered stable builds, improved balance, richer gameplay interactions, and more robust data pipelines, enabling faster iteration and more reliable community deployments.
November 2024 highlights: Delivered new LightLevel support for URANIUM_ORE and DEEPSLATE_URANIUM_ORE to improve in-game rendering and logic accuracy. Consolidated enrich/fire block mixins for Ghast explosions into a single, maintainable approach, reducing complexity and maintenance overhead. Advanced IrradiatedMob lifecycle by updating creation method and registry alignment, complemented by a datagen cache fix to ensure reliable data generation. Strengthened build and release pipelines with targeted fixes and workflow updates, accelerating mod publishing and packaging, and added datagen and crafting data enhancements to improve build reliability and parity with design specs. These changes deliver tangible business value by improving rendering fidelity, reducing integration risk, ensuring consistent data generation, and enabling faster, more reliable mod releases.
November 2024 highlights: Delivered new LightLevel support for URANIUM_ORE and DEEPSLATE_URANIUM_ORE to improve in-game rendering and logic accuracy. Consolidated enrich/fire block mixins for Ghast explosions into a single, maintainable approach, reducing complexity and maintenance overhead. Advanced IrradiatedMob lifecycle by updating creation method and registry alignment, complemented by a datagen cache fix to ensure reliable data generation. Strengthened build and release pipelines with targeted fixes and workflow updates, accelerating mod publishing and packaging, and added datagen and crafting data enhancements to improve build reliability and parity with design specs. These changes deliver tangible business value by improving rendering fidelity, reducing integration risk, ensuring consistent data generation, and enabling faster, more reliable mod releases.
Concise monthly summary for 2024-10 focusing on key accomplishments, major bug fixes, and overall impact. Highlights include data updates for mod resources, reactor controller orientation stability, and debugging/logging cleanup for the SimpleMultiBlockAislePatternBuilder. These changes improve data integrity, gameplay reliability, and maintainability.
Concise monthly summary for 2024-10 focusing on key accomplishments, major bug fixes, and overall impact. Highlights include data updates for mod resources, reactor controller orientation stability, and debugging/logging cleanup for the SimpleMultiBlockAislePatternBuilder. These changes improve data integrity, gameplay reliability, and maintainability.
Overview of all repositories you've contributed to across your timeline